Contact: Pat Pembertonppembert@calpoly.edu; 805-235-0555 SAN LUIS OBISPO, Calif. — As graduating college students seek to launch their careers, artificial intelligence is increasingly changing the way job searches are conducted, with both recruiters and applicants using the technology. “AI and generative AI are increasingly embedded in applicant tracking systems,” said Ben Alexander, associate professor of management at the Cal Poly’s Orfalea College of Business. “Major systems can conversati...
